Jake Paul brutally floored Adin Ross with a body shot using just ’10 per cent’ of his power.

Paul joined Ross on his podcast following the shock announcement of his fight against Mike Tyson.

He fired back at KSI criticising his showdown against Tyson.

Paul and Ross also shared the ring, with ‘The Problem Child’ showcasing his power.

The 9-1 boxer, who recently scored a big win over Ryan Bourland, hit the popular streamer with a body shot.

Ross asked for ’10 per cent’ of Paul’s power, but still dropped him to his knees in a crazy moment. Check it out below:

Paul delivered a debilitating left-hand to Ross’ body using a portion of his power.

Ross crumbled to his hands and knees from 10 per cent of Paul’s power.

Paul admitted: “Low key that was 15 [per cent]. I went a litter harder than 10 [per cent].”

The 27-year-old has stopped six opponents in his professional career including a monstrous knockout win over former UFC welterweight champion Tyron Woodley.

He takes on Tyson, who still carries his legendary power as he showed off his hands in a new training video.

On fighting ‘Iron’ Mike, Paul said: “It’s crazy to think that in my second pro fight I went viral for knocking out Nate Robinson on Mike Tyson’s undercard.

“Now, less than four years later, I’m stepping up to face Tyson myself to see if I have what it takes to beat one of boxing’s most notorious fighters and biggest icons. Within just two and a half years of founding MVP, we’re about to produce the biggest fight in history, a fight in the biggest NFL stadium in the US, broadcast live, on the biggest streaming platform in the world – a testament to all we’ve accomplished in such a short amount of time.”
